I'm always happy to stay there, and the friends that I've recommended it to have enjoyed it too. The check-in is very friendly, maybe because they are sitting down at desks instead of standing on aching feet all day. The front desk also provides helpful and knowledgeable concierge service. The highlight of the hotel for me is its nightly happy hour, which features an excellent antipasto bar and a variety of beers and wines. The complimentary breakfast is also quite nice, since it is set up on each floor, although I would appreciate some more lower-carb options, like a wider variety of unsweetened cereals. Personally, during four separate stays, my room has always been quiet and comfortable, but reading the other reviews, I suppose you have to be careful about the garbage truck and alley noises. Again, I've never run it that problem myself. The location is ideal, within walking distance of quite a few destination restaurants. No pool, but the exercise room is great.
